Background on Germany’s Green Bond Program

Germany has been actively developing its green bond market since 2020, with the federal government issuing bonds designated for environmentally sustainable projects. The three bonds involved in this tender are among the most prominent in Germany’s green debt portfolio. Previous issuances have seen growing investor interest, driven by increasing demand for sustainable investment options. The recent tender results follow a series of successful green bond issuances by other European governments, reflecting a broader regional trend toward sustainable debt. The Bundesbank’s role as a central counterparty in the tender process emphasizes the importance of transparency and market confidence in these instruments.
